The Cycles of Change™ program includes the following:
- Understanding the Seasonal Model – Get an overview of the certification program, build an in-depth understanding of the cyclical model and explore personal experiences in life transition (both tracks). 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Thursday, Sept. 27.
- Communication Skills Building and Using the Model as an Assessment Tool Deepen the understanding of the model and how to use in working with people using case studies and personal experiences (both tracks). 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Friday, Sept. 28.
- Application of the Model in Working with Individuals – Discussion and practical application of the model using case studies and personal experience (individual track only). 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Thursday, Oct. 4 and 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Friday, Oct. 5 .
- Application of the Model in Working with Groups – Practical applications using the model in group work (group track only). 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Thursday, Oct. 18 and 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Friday, Oct. 19.
- Ethics – Exploration and clarification of ethical issues in working with groups and individuals (both tracks). Noon to 5 p.m. Thursday, Nov. 1.
- Application Facilitation – More practice using the cycle and planning for individual and/or group track evaluations (both tracks). 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Friday, Nov. 2.
- Individual Track Evaluations – TBD (time depends on number of students; date usually decided on first day of class).
- Group Track Evaluations – TBD (time depends on number of students; date usually decided on first day of class).
- Internships: Each student will be assigned a coach and will receive six hours of one-on-one mentoring to deepen his/her understanding of the cycle. Students will be expected to use the cycle in individual and/or group work during this time so that the coach and student can review the student’s practical application of the cycle. Students taking both tracks will have a coach for each track.
